Melina Masihi, MD, PhD, is a physician–scientist and former Director of Clinical Programs at Northwestern Hospital and Northwestern University Feinberg School of Medicine, where she spent more than a decade improving clinical pathways, advancing early diagnosis, and strengthening the patient experience across gastroenterology, oncology, and hematology. With over 12 years of clinical practice and leadership across more than 70 clinical trials, she is recognized for her commitment to reducing diagnostic delays, expanding access to care, and elevating patient education for diverse communities.

Dr. Masihi earned her MD and PhD in Oncology and Healthcare Services, combining clinical depth with systems-level insight. She has collaborated with leading global pharmaceutical and medical technology organizations, including AstraZeneca, Merck, Medtronic, and Boehringer Ingelheim, to design patient-centered research, enhance diagnostic strategies, and support innovations that improve outcomes across the care continuum.

In addition to her academic and industry contributions, Dr. Masihi serves with the Stanford High Impact Technology (HIT) Fund, evaluating early-stage technologies that empower patients and address unmet needs in timely, equitable care delivery. She remains dedicated to advancing healthcare that is not only clinically excellent but also compassionate, accessible, and deeply human. She also serves on InnoTech’s Medical and Scientific Advisory Board, where she guides strategy for biomarker discovery and early cancer detection. Her leadership supports the advancement of precision diagnostics, reflecting an unwavering commitment to healthcare that is clinically excellent, compassionate, and profoundly human-centered.
